Abstract
We propose a new multidirectional associative memory (MAM) termed combined multi-winner MAM (CMW-MAM) using a distributed representation paradigm in this paper. The proposed CMW-MAM stores and recalls information hierarchically by the distributed representations which are automatically generated in the networks. The proposed CMW-MAM can handle analog information and it can store and recall composite many-to-many memory structures such as episodes-to-episodes associations. The association properties for the storage of composite many-to-many memory structures such as associations from some episodes to other episodes are studied. The basic properties for many-to-many association such as storage capacity, noise performance and robustness are also investigated in detail.
